Driveway pad installation involves creating a durable, level surface that provides a stable area for parking vehicles and accessing a property. This service typically includes preparing the existing ground, laying a solid foundation, and applying a finished surface such as concrete, asphalt, or paving stones. Proper installation ensures the driveway can withstand daily use, resist cracking, and maintain its appearance over time. Service providers who specialize in driveway pads can help homeowners achieve a functional and attractive entrance that enhances the overall curb appeal of their property.
Many property owners turn to driveway pad installation to address common problems like uneven or cracked surfaces, which can pose safety hazards or cause damage to vehicles. Over time, driveways may develop potholes, erosion, or shifting due to soil movement or weather conditions. Installing a new driveway pad can resolve these issues by providing a stable, even surface that prevents further deterioration. Additionally, a well-installed driveway can improve drainage, reducing the risk of water pooling or flooding around the property’s entrance.

The overview below groups typical Driveway Pad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in San Francisco, CA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or driveway pad repairs or patching often range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and materials needed.
Standard Installation - Installing a new driveway pad usually costs between $1,200 and $3,500. Most projects in San Francisco and nearby areas tend to land in this range, with fewer reaching the higher end for larger or more complex setups.
Full Replacement - Complete driveway pad replacement can range from $4,000 to $8,000 or more. Larger, more intricate projects or those involving custom materials can push costs beyond this range, though these are less common.
Custom or Complex Projects - Highly customized or complex driveway installations, such as decorative finishes or extensive grading, can exceed $10,000. These projects are typically tailored to specific needs and are less frequently encountered by local contractors.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When evaluating potential contractors for driveway pad installation,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should inquire about how long the service providers have been working on driveway installations and whether they have completed projects comparable in size, style, or material to what is desired. A contractor with a solid track record of handling driveway pads in the local area can often better anticipate site-specific challenges and deliver results that meet expectations.
Clear, written expectations are essential for a smooth project. Homeowners should seek service providers who can provide detailed proposals outlining the scope of work, materials to be used, and any relevant specifications. Having these details in writing helps ensure everyone is aligned on the project’s goals and reduces the likelihood of misunderstandings or surprises during construction. It’s also helpful to ask whether the contractor is comfortable addressing questions or adjustments before work begins.
Reputable references and effective communication are key indicators of a trustworthy local contractor. Homeowners should ask for references from previous clients with similar projects and follow up to learn about their experiences. Good communication throughout the process-such as responsiveness, clarity in explanations, and willingness to discuss concerns-can greatly influence satisfaction with the final outcome.
